Training for an Ultra on Low Volume
The hosts discuss whether it is feasible to train for an ultra on low running volume and debate the minimum mileage necessary for different race distances. They emphasize the importance of understanding a person's background and history when determining their capabilities and discuss the factors that influence training, such as time constraints and the ability to recover. The chapter concludes with a suggestion to run as much as possible and then increase intensity once time is maxed out.
